  1. Are funny passwords really secure?
    While humor might not be the secret ingredient for creating the most secure passwords, it’s important to strike a balance between security and memorability. Avoid using obvious combinations like “password123,” but feel free to incorporate humor to make it unique and personal to you. Just remember to avoid easily guessable patterns and include a mix of letters, numbers, and special characters.

  2. Is two-factor authentication necessary if I have strong passwords?
    Absolutely! Two-factor authentication (2FA) adds an extra layer of security, even if you already have strong passwords. It provides an additional barrier for potential hackers, making it significantly more difficult for them to compromise your accounts. Think of 2FA as your secret weapon against digital miscreants.

  3. Can VPNs be trusted with my privacy?
    While VPNs can enhance your online privacy and security, it’s essential to choose a reputable and trustworthy VPN service. Look for providers with a solid track record, transparent privacy policies, and a large user base. It’s also advisable to opt for paid VPN services, as they generally offer better security measures and privacy protection.

  4. Can I protect my privacy on social media without quitting altogether?
    Absolutely! Social media platforms provide a range of privacy settings that allow you to control who sees your posts, photos, and personal information. Take the time to customize your privacy settings according to your preferences. Remember, it’s your online space, and you have the power to decide who gets a front-row seat to your virtual life.
